As part of our front of house team, you'll often be the first voice a client hears or the first face they see when they arrive. That first interaction sets the tone for their entire experience, so kindness, empathy and clear communication are at the heart of this role.
Your days will be varied and busy. You'll help clients book appointments, answer questions over the phone, via our Pets app and by email, and make sure the practice runs smoothly behind the scenes. You'll also support the clinical team with important administrative tasks and help maintain accurate records. Most importantly, you'll provide reassurance and guidance to pet owners who may be worried or unsure about what to do next.
We're looking for someone who enjoys working with people, who can stay calm and organised in a fast paced environment, and who takes pride in delivering excellent service. Previous customer facing experience is helpful, but what matters most is your attitude - being approachable, compassionate and ready to help.
